Ingredients for caesar chicken wings
10 - 20 Chicken Wings
1 tsp. Salt
1 tsp. Pepper
1 tsp. Garlic, Minced
3 tbsp. Olive Oil
1/3 cup Mayonnaise
1 tbsp. Dijon Mustard
1/4 cup Parmesan Cheese, finely grated
1 Lemon, juiced
1 tsp. Pepper
1 clove Garlic, minced
1 tbsp. Fresh Parsley, minced

Method for caesar chicken wings
Preheat propane or electric grill to medium. In a medium bowl add chicken wings and season with olive oil, salt, pepper and garlic. Toss over wings so they are evenly coated and add to the hot grill over medium heat. Let wings cook covered on one side for 5 minutes.
Make the caesar dressing, in a large clean bowl, add mayonnaise, dijon, parm, lemon, pepper, garlic and parsley and whisk to combine. Adjust to taste, adding more cheese, garlic or lemon if desired.
Back to the grill, uncover and flip chicken wings to cook on second side. Skin should be crispy, and slightly charred. If the flames are too high, turn down to medium low heat and cook on second side for five minutes. Once wings are fully cooked, remove from the grill and immediately toss to coat in Caesar dressing. Serve warm.
